Mobile gamers should notice less delay - or latency - when ...5G uses three different bands, each using different parts of the radio spectrum. Low, medium, and high bands offer performance with inversely varying speed and distance attributes. Low band is the slowest of the three but performs the best over distances and through surfaces. And, according to Collins, “all wireless communications use nonionizing electromagnetic radiation to transmit ...5G also has far lower latency than LTE, meaning it transfers data with less delay. It’s technically capable of latency as low as 1 millisecond (ms) compared to LTE’s average of around 50ms, but 5G often averages out at 10-20ms in practice. The promise is faster data speeds, low latency connections, and a ... Sub-6 versus mmWave. When 5G was rolling out, the industry divided the frequencies into two generally broad ranges: Sub-6GHz (Sub-6) and millimeter wave (mmWave).
